Description
(R)-Pantetheine is the biosynthetic precursor to CoA.(R)-Pantetheine and its corresponding disulfide pantethine, play a key role in metabolism as a building block of coenzyme A (CoA)[1].
Pantetheine is an amide obtained by formal condensation of the carboxy group of pantothenic acid and the amino group of cysteamine. It has a role as a metabolite, a human metabolite and a mouse metabolite. It is a thiol and a member of pantetheines.|An intermediate in the pathway of coenzyme A formation in mammalian liver and some microorganisms.
